This manual provides instructions for the Tzumi 2000mAh Power Bank. It covers the charging process for the power bank itself, how to charge your mobile devices, and how to interpret the LED status lights. Always use the provided USB cable for optimal performance.

Specifications
- Battery: 2000mAh lithium ion
- Input: 5V/1A
- Output: 5V/1A
LED Light Indicators
- Solid Blue: Power Bank is charging your device.
- Flashing Blue: Power Bank needs to be charged.
- Flashing Red: Power Bank is being charged.
- Solid Red: Power Bank is done being charged.
- Flashing Red and Blue: Some models may display this while charging.
Charging the Power Bank
- Connect the provided USB charging cable to the Power Bank.
- Plug the other end into a computer or a USB powered supply of DC 5V.
- The LED light will flash red while charging and turn solid red when complete.
- Charging takes approximately 2-4 hours, depending on the current of your charging source.
Charging your Device
- Plug the USB end of the cable into the charged Power Bank.
- Connect the charging tip specific to your device into your device.
- The LED light will turn solid blue when charging begins.
- If the LED does not turn on, press the Power Button on the Power Bank.
- The Power Bank provides approximately 1 full smartphone charge, depending on your device's power needs.
Safety Precautions
- Do not use the device near any water source.
- Do not attempt to modify, try to repair, or disassemble the device.
- Do not use chemical detergents to clean the device; use a soft, dry cloth.
